Transaction 8b8393bfafb398ab4d14ea58205befc825ad073d06d8a1bd34ba655a8760c899
1 Input
1 Output
-
8b8393bfafb398ab4d14ea58205befc825ad073d06d8a1bd34ba655a8760c899:0
- value
- 1803025
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 28d6fc8b83e9ea29f884652e62af9e91563501a5 OP_EQUAL
- address
- 35QxVjwQtvkytxDwp59zUt1sCcsjgqMQHz